What this Himalaya buck does on your rail
The MAX15462CATA+T is a step-down (buck) switching regulator from Maxim Integrated's Himalaya series, delivering up to 300 mA from a 4.5 V to 42 V input rail. The output is adjustable from 0.9 V up to 37.37 V, set by an external resistor divider. Synchronous rectification is built in, so no external catch diode is needed — that saves board area and improves efficiency, especially at light loads. Switching frequency is fixed at 500 kHz, which keeps the inductor small while staying below the AM band. The operating temperature range of -40°C to 125°C covers automotive under-hood and industrial enclosures where ambient heat is a given. The part comes in an 8-TDFN (2x2 mm) package, surface-mount, and is ROHS3 compliant.
300 mA output — sizing the load budget
300 mA is the continuous output rating. That covers a sensor module, a small microcontroller plus its peripherals, or an isolated bias supply.
Synchronous rectification — efficiency without the diode
The built-in synchronous rectifier replaces the usual Schottky catch diode. That eliminates the diode's forward voltage drop and its reverse-recovery losses, which matters at 500 kHz switching.
